Bosnia and Herzegovina -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als
Since 2014, Bosnia and Herzegovina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als fell by 2.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 25 comparing other countries in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als with $81,974,256. Bosnia and Herzegovina is overtaken by Serbia, which was number 24 with $82,122,152.5 and is followed by Japan with $61,791,164. China topped the ranking with $1,724,061,186.57 in 2019, a growth of 2.4% versus 2018. Mexico, United States and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nicaragua recorded the best 5 years average growth at +263.4% per year, while Malawi recorded the worst performance at -70% per year.
